According to Reactance Theory, when people's freedom of choice is restricted, **they may desire the forbidden option more and act aggressively**. This theory suggests that individuals experience a psychological reaction against perceived threats to their autonomy, leading to an increased desire for the restricted choice and potentially aggressive behaviors to reclaim their freedom.
